|
|
|
@ -268,12 +268,11 @@ public class BuyerController { |
|
|
|
|
} |
|
|
|
|
List<BuyerEntity> buyerEntityList = new ArrayList<>(); |
|
|
|
|
Collection<List<BuyerImportExcel>> values = importExcelList.stream().collect(Collectors.groupingBy(t -> t.getGhfBm())).values(); |
|
|
|
|
values.stream().map(t->{ |
|
|
|
|
if(t.size() > 1){ |
|
|
|
|
return R.error("购方编码存在重复项!"); |
|
|
|
|
for (List<BuyerImportExcel> value : values) { |
|
|
|
|
if(value.size() > 1){ |
|
|
|
|
return R.error("表内购方编码存在重复项,请检查!"); |
|
|
|
|
} |
|
|
|
|
return t; |
|
|
|
|
}); |
|
|
|
|
} |
|
|
|
|
for (BuyerImportExcel buyerImportExcel : importExcelList) { |
|
|
|
|
BuyerEntity buyerEntity = new BuyerEntity(); |
|
|
|
|
buyerEntity.setPurchaseName(buyerImportExcel.getGhfMc()); |
|
|
|
|